/*
* Copyright 2014-2023 The GmSSL Project. All Rights Reserved.
*
* Licensed under the Apache License, Version 2.0 (the License); you may
* not use this file except in compliance with the License.
*
* http://www.apache.org/licenses/LICENSE-2.0
*/
package org.gmssl;
import org.junit.Assert;
import org.junit.Before;
import org.junit.FixMethodOrder;
import org.junit.Test;
import org.junit.runners.MethodSorters;
import java.io.*;
import java.util.Map;
/**
* @author yongfei.li
* @email 290836576@qq.com
* @date 2023/10/20
* @description sm9 unit test
*/
@FixMethodOrder(MethodSorters.NAME_ASCENDING)
public class Sm9Test {
@Test
public void signTest() {
String singContentStr = "gmssl";
byte[] singContent = singContentStr.getBytes();
Sm9SignMasterKey sign_master_key = new Sm9SignMasterKey();
sign_master_key.generateMasterKey();
Sm9SignKey sign_key = sign_master_key.extractKey("testKey");
Sm9Signature sign = new Sm9Signature(true);
sign.update(singContent);
byte[] sig = sign.sign(sign_key);
sign_master_key.exportPublicMasterKeyPem("sm9sign.mpk");
String hexSig = HexUtil.byteToHex(sig);
//System.out.println(hexSig);
writeFile("sm9SignData.txt",hexSig);
Assert.assertNotNull("data is empty exception!",hexSig);
}
@Test
public void verifyTest(){
String hexSig=readFile("sm9SignData.txt");
byte[] sig=HexUtil.hexToByte(hexSig);
String singContentStr = "gmssl";
byte[] singContent = singContentStr.getBytes();
Sm9SignMasterKey sign_master_pub_key = new Sm9SignMasterKey();
sign_master_pub_key.importPublicMasterKeyPem("sm9sign.mpk");
Sm9Signature verify = new Sm9Signature(false);
verify.update(singContent);
boolean verify_ret = verify.verify(sig, sign_master_pub_key, "testKey");
//System.out.println("Verify result = " + verify_ret);
Assert.assertTrue("Verification of the signature failed!",verify_ret);
}
/**
* The encryption test method will generate a file, which will be used by the decryption test method ,
* the encryption test method needs to be run before the decryption test method.
*/
@Test
public void _encryptTest(){
String plaintextStr = "gmssl";
byte[] plaintext = plaintextStr.getBytes();
Sm9EncMasterKey enc_master_key = new Sm9EncMasterKey();
enc_master_key.generateMasterKey();
enc_master_key.exportEncryptedMasterKeyInfoPem("password","sm9enc.mpk");
Sm9EncMasterKey enc_master_pub_key = new Sm9EncMasterKey();
enc_master_pub_key.importEncryptedMasterKeyInfoPem("password","sm9enc.mpk");
byte[] ciphertext = enc_master_pub_key.encrypt(plaintext, "testKey");
String ciphertextHex=HexUtil.byteToHex(ciphertext);
//System.out.println(ciphertextHex);
writeFile("sm9EncryptData.txt",ciphertextHex);
Assert.assertNotNull("data is empty exception!",ciphertextHex);
}
@Test
public void decryptTest(){
String ciphertextHex=readFile("sm9EncryptData.txt");
byte[] ciphertext=HexUtil.hexToByte(ciphertextHex);
Sm9EncMasterKey enc_master_key = new Sm9EncMasterKey();
enc_master_key.importEncryptedMasterKeyInfoPem("password","sm9enc.mpk");
Sm9EncKey enc_key = enc_master_key.extractKey("testKey");
byte[] plaintext = enc_key.decrypt(ciphertext);
String plaintextStr = new String(plaintext);
//System.out.print(plaintextStr);
Assert.assertEquals("The original value is not equal to the expected value after decryption!","gmssl",plaintextStr);
}
/**
* Write string data to a temporary file.
* @param fileName
* @param data
*/
private void writeFile(String fileName,String data){
File tempFile = new File("./"+ fileName);
try {
if(tempFile.exists()){
tempFile.delete();
}else {
tempFile.createNewFile();
}
} catch (IOException e) {
e.printStackTrace();
}
try (BufferedWriter writer = new BufferedWriter(new FileWriter("./" + fileName))) {
writer.write(data);
} catch (IOException e) {
e.printStackTrace();
}
}
/**
* Read string data from a temporary file.
* @param fileName
* @return String data
*/
private String readFile(String fileName){
FileReader fileReader = null;
StringBuilder data= new StringBuilder();
try {
fileReader = new FileReader(new File( "./"+fileName));
BufferedReader bufferedReader = new BufferedReader(fileReader);
String line;
while ((line = bufferedReader.readLine()) != null) {
data.append(line);
}
bufferedReader.close();
} catch (IOException e) {
e.printStackTrace();
throw new RuntimeException(e);
}
return data.toString();
}
}
